| coruscation | <symptom> Rarely used psychiatric term for a subjective sensation of a flash of light before the eyes. Origin: L. Corusco, to flash (05 Mar 2000) |

| coruscation |
glitter: the occurrence of a small flash or spark a sudden or striking display of brilliance; "coruscations of great wit"
